Das Verwalten von Anforderungen als Synonym zu Requirements-Management ist eine Teildisziplin des Requirements-Engineerings und beschreibt die Prinzipien und Methoden, Anforderungen und andere relevante Informationen so abzulegen, dass jeder Beteiligte das findet, was er braucht. Dabei unterstütz der Requirements-Engineering-Leitfaden als zentrales Dokument bei der Umsetzung der Prinzipien und Methoden. Um Anforderungsspezifikationen ab einem gewissen Umfang beherrschbar zu machen, kommen spezialisierte Requirements-Management- oder Modellierung-Tools zum Einsatz, die an den unternehmensspezifischen Entwicklungsprozess und die verwendeten Requirements-Engineering-Methoden angepasst sein sollten.

Grundsätzliches

Requirements-Management umfasst Maßnahmen, die die Anforderungsanalyse und die weitere Verwendung von Anforderungen unterstützt. Zu diesen Maßnahmen gehören unter anderem:

  • Strukturierung des Anforderungsdokumentes
  • Definition von Attributen zur Verwaltung der Anforderungen
  • Herstellung der Nachvollziehbarkeit von Änderungen an Dokumentationen
  • Herstellung der Nachvollziehbarkeit von Abhängigkeiten von Informationen untereinander
  • Verbesserung der Kommunikation zwischen den Projektbeteiligten
  • Effektive Verknüpfung von Informationen mit Hilfe einer Toolunterstützung
  • Erfassen aller Projektbeteiligten und Definition der benötigten Arbeitsschritte  unter Verwendung eines definierten Workflow-Konzepts für die Verwaltung
  • Dokumentation von Informationen zum Fortschritt des Entwicklungsprozesses

Requirements-Management-Methoden

Zur Definition des Lebenszyklus einer Anforderung bzw. anderen relevanten Informationen ist es wichtig beim Requirements-Management strukturiert vorzugehen. Dafür sorgen unterschiedliche Methoden zur Verwaltung von Anforderungen:

  • Definition von den möglichen Zuständen einer Anforderung von z.B. angelegt bis getestet
  • Definition von Arbeitsabläufen für jede Rolle, die mit einer Anforderung im Rahmen der Verwaltung in Berührung kommen kann
  • Definition eines Versionierungsschemas von Anforderungen
  • Definition eines Attributierungsschema um große Mengen von Anforderungen zu beherrschen und z.B. Teilmengen durch Filtern oder Sichtenbildung herauszulösen und gleichzeitig bearbeiten zu können
  • Definition eines Traceabilitykonzepts zur Gewährleistung der Verfolgbarkeit von Anforderungen
  • Verwendung einer gut durchdachten Gliederung, wie z.B. die SOPHIST DOHA Gliederung, die SOPHIST IVENA Gliederung oder den Gliederungsansatz nach STABLE
  • Etablierung eines Change- und Release-Managements mit einem definierten Prozess
  • Definition von Wiederverwendungskonzepte zur langfristigen Verbesserung der Produktivität

Toolevaluierung – Requirements-Management-Tool

Ab einem gewissen Spezifikationsumfang ist der Einsatz von einem professionellen Requirements-Management-Tool fast unabdingbar. Bei der Toolauswahl  ist es wichtig, ein Tool auszuwählen, das den vorher definierten Requirements-Engineering-Prozess abbildet. Fatal wäre es, dass aufgrund der Vorgaben des Tools ein neuer Prozess gestaltet werden muss. Auch das Thema Datenmigration aus alten Requirements-Management-Lösungen sollte nicht außer Acht gelassen werden.

Bekannte Requirements-Management-Tools auf dem Markt sind z.B.:

  • Rational DOORS und Rational DOORS Next Generation von IBM
  • Visure Reqirements von VISURE SOLUTIONS
  • Team Foundation Server von Microsoft
  • Polarion von Siemens
  • Rational RequisitePro von IBM
  • Integrity von PTC
  • Atego Requirements Synchronize von Atego
  • Jama von Jama Software
  • HP Application Lifecycle Management (HP ALM) von HP Software Division of Hewlett Packard Enterprise
  • Caliber von MICRO FOCUS
  • Jira von Atlassian in Kombination mit  Confluence von Atlassian
  • Codebeamer von Intland
  • MediaWiki von Wikimedia Foundation

 

Zur Modellierung von Anforderungen sind auf dem Markt z.B. die nachfolgenden Tools bekannt:

  • Enterprise Architect von Sparx Systems
  • Innovator von  MID
  • MagicDraw von No Magic Inc.
  • Visio von Microsoft
  • Rational Rose Enterprise von IBM
  • TAU G2 von IBM
  • ARIS von Software AG
  • PowerDesigner von SYBASE
  • Silk Together von Micro Focus
  • Balsamiq Mockups von Balsamiq Studios
  • Rational Rhapsody von IBM
  • Yed von yWorks
  • Bizagi Modeler BPMN von Bizagi

 

Einführung von Requirements-Management

Die Einführung von Requirements-Management ist Teil einer Requirements-Engineering-Einführung. Dabei ist diese meist gleichgesetzt mit der Einführung eines Requirements-Management-Tools. Für eine erfolgreiche Einführung der Methoden des Requirements-Management und evtl. eines entsprechenden Tools ist es wichtig, ein Einführungskonzept zu entwickeln, das z.B. ein erfolgreiches Marketing- und Wissenstransferkonzept enthält und die Kriterien für geeignete Pilotprojekte definiert.

Sie haben noch Fragen?

Bei Fragen zu den Themen und Angeboten der SOPHISTen stehen wir Ihnen gerne zur Verfügung: Von der Organisation und Vorbereitung über die Durchführung bis hin zur Nachbereitung. Ihr Ansprechpartner hilft Ihnen gerne weiter.

Ihre Ansprechpartner:

vertrieb[at]sophist[dot]de

+49 (0)9 11 40 900 64

Ihre Ansprechpartner:

vertrieb[at]sophist[dot]de

+49 (0)9 11 40 900 63

Ihre Ansprechpartner:

vertrieb[at]sophist[dot]de

+49 (0)9 11 40 900 78

Ihre Ansprechpartner:

vertrieb[at]sophist[dot]de

+49 (0)9 11 40 900 62

AUS UNSEREM SOPHIST BLOG

Letzter Praxisvortrag für die SOPHIST DAYS 2018 steht!

In zwei Wochen ist es soweit – die SOPHIST DAYS 2018 finden statt. Mit dabei sind jetzt auch Matthias Strößner von der Robert Bosch Automotive Steering GmbH und Christian Bock von den SOPHISTen. Mit Ihrem Praxisvortrag SysEng 2.0 – Das …

„Videos im RE“ oder auch „Männer die auf Specs starren“

Stellen Sie sich vor, Sie teilen Ihre Systemanforderungen mit den Stakeholdern – alle Teilnehmer verstehen, nicken und Sie können zufrieden, ruhigen Gewissens nach Hause gehen. Der Klassiker unter den Träumen eines Requirements-Engineer. Der Grund dafür, dass dies manchmal fern der …

Alter Wein in neuen Schläuchen

Tut mir leid, es geht hier nur am Rande um Wein. Aber um ein ALTbekanntes Problem. Wie bekomme ich das Wissen, das in meinen Anforderungen dokumentiert ist, in die Köpfe der Weiterbearbeiter? Dieser Frage sind ein paar SOPHISTen nachgegangen und …

GI-Fachruppentreffen – „RE im Wandel der Gesellschaft“

Das diesjährige Treffen der Fachgruppe Requirements Engineering der Gesellschaft für Informatik (GI)  findet wie jedes Jahr in der letzten Novemberwoche statt. Heuer haben die SOPHISTen die Ehre, die Gastgeber für das Treffen am 29. – 30.11.2018 zum Thema „RE im …

Ein Crowdsourcing-Prozess – Die Durchführungsphase

Was Sie bei der Planung Ihres Crowdsourcings bedenken sollten, haben wir Ihnen bereits in unserem letzten Beitrag „Ein Crowdsourcing-Prozess: Die Planungsphase“ erläutert. Nun sehen wir uns das Kernstück des Prozesses an – die Durchführungsphase. Crowdsourcing vorbereiten Richtlinien ausarbeiten Erarbeiten Sie …

Copyright 2018

SOPHIST GmbH

Sie benötigen weitere Informationen?

Rufen Sie uns an und lassen Sie sich direkt an den richtigen Ansprechpartner durchstellen?

Tel:      +49 (0)9 11 40 90 00

E-Mail: heureka[at]sophist[dot]de

Unsere Bürozeiten sind:        Montag bis Donnerstag:                         Freitag:
                                              08:00 - 12:00 Uhr                                    08:00 - 12:00 Uhr
                                              13:00 - 18:00 Uhr                                    13:00 - 17:00 Uhr



Natürlich können sie auch gerne direkt per E-Mail diverse Abteilungen erreichen:

Rund um das Thema Trainings:

training[at]sophist[dot]de

 



Rund um das Thema Projekt- und Beratungstätigkeiten

vertrieb[at]sophist[dot]de

 



Rund um unsere Stellenangebote und Ihren Karrierechancen bei SOPHIST

DeineZukunft[at]sophist[dot]de


 

Zu Events und Marketing sowie unseren Publikationen

messe[at]sophist[dot]de

 

SOPHIST GmbH

Allgemein:

Internes Team

heureka@sophist.de
+49 (0)9 11 40 90 00

 

Bei Fragen und Anregungen zu unseren Trainings und zu Projekt- und Beratungstätigkeiten wenden Sie sich bitte an:

Trainingsadministration und Vertrieb

training[at]sophist[dot]de

vertrieb@sophist.de
+49 (0)9 11 40 90 00

 

 

Bei Fragen und Anregungen zu unseren Stellenangeboten und Ihren Karrierechancen bei SOPHIST sowie zu Events und Marketing wenden Sie sich bitte an:

HR und Marketing

DeineZukunft@sophist.de

messe@sophist.de
+49 (0)9 11 40 90 00